- Primary Base (The Tent): A small, waterproof, one-person tent is your portable living room. Find a discreet location and adapt to your climate. Staying dry is often the first priority.
- Day Shelter (The Library): The local Public Library system is your daytime embassy. It is a safe, quiet, and climate-controlled environment where you can rest, read, and be without being hassled, almost always without needing a library card.
- Hygiene & Health (The Refresh): Consistent access to a shower is crucial for both physical and mental well-being.
- Nationwide Hotline: The simplest way to find local resources is to dial 2-1-1. This is a free, confidential service that connects you to local health and human services. Ask them for the nearest "day shelter with shower facilities" or "rescue mission."
- A gym membership (like Planet Fitness) can also be a surprisingly affordable and consistent option for daily showers if you can manage the monthly fee.

- Fishing: Check your state's Fish and Wildlife website for local regulations. Many states offer free or very low-cost shoreline fishing licenses for residents. This is a beautiful way to combine sustenance with quiet, meditative play.
- Consistent Meals:
- Nationwide Food Bank Locator: The Feeding America website (FeedingAmerica.org) has a nationwide network of food banks. You can use their "Find a Food Bank" tool to locate pantries, soup kitchens, and community meals in any zip code.
- Again, dialing 2-1-1 is a powerful tool for finding daily meal programs nearby.

- Power (The Lifeblood):
- Your Primary Tool: A portable power bank (a battery pack) is essential. A good one can charge your Chromebook and Pixel multiple times. This is your most important piece of gear.
- Charging Stations: The local Public Library is your most reliable charging location. Find a comfortable corner and make it your "office." Many city buses also have USB charging ports.
- Internet (The Signal):
- Primary Hub: Again, the Public Library offers free, reliable, high-speed Wi-Fi.
- Secondary Hubs: Many parks, public squares, and businesses like Starbucks and McDonald's offer free public Wi-Fi. Your Pixel phone can also act as a temporary hotspot if needed.

- Receiving Money/Mail:
- General Delivery: You can have mail sent to you via General Delivery at almost any main Post Office branch in the country.
- Shelter Addresses: Ask at a local day shelter if they allow guests to use their address to receive mail.

- Practical Help (The Hospital, Not the Courtroom):
- SAMHSA National Helpline: For help with substance use and mental health, call 1-800-662-HELP (4357). It's a free, confidential, 24/7 treatment referral and information service.
- 988 Suicide & Crisis Lifeline: If the darkness ever feels too heavy, dialing 988 will connect you immediately to a trained crisis counselor. It is a lifeline of grace in a moment of need.
